在当今信息化时代,管理系统的权限管理是确保数据安全、维护组织秩序的关键。一个精心设计的权限管理系统能够有效地控制对系统资源的访问,防止未授权的访问和操作,从而保护敏感信息不被泄露或滥用。以下是如何构建一个高效、安全的权限管理系统的方法:
1. 明确权限需求
- 角色定义:根据组织的组织结构和业务流程,定义不同的角色,如管理员、编辑、审批等。每个角色应具有相应的职责和权限,以便于管理和操作。
- 权限分配:为每个角色分配必要的权限,确保他们能够执行其职责所需的操作。例如,管理员可能有权创建新用户、修改用户信息和分配权限,而编辑则可能只能查看和修改特定内容。
2. 设计权限模型
- 最小权限原则:确保每个用户仅拥有完成其任务所必需的最少权限。这意味着不应授予过多的权限,以防止潜在的安全风险。
- 角色依赖性:设计权限模型时,考虑不同角色之间的依赖关系。例如,某些操作可能需要多个角色的共同权限才能完成,如审核和批准流程。
3. 实现权限控制
- 基于角色的访问控制:通过实施基于角色的访问控制,可以确保用户只能访问其角色所允许的资源。这有助于防止用户无意中访问敏感信息或执行不当操作。
- 多因素认证:引入多因素认证机制,如密码加验证码或生物识别技术,以提高账户安全性。这可以增加攻击者获取访问权限的难度,并提高系统的整体安全性。
4. 定期审计与监控
- 日志记录:记录所有用户活动,包括登录尝试、权限更改和关键操作。这有助于追踪潜在的安全事件和异常行为。
- 实时监控:实施实时监控系统,以便及时发现和响应潜在的安全威胁。这包括对异常行为的检测和报警,以及对潜在安全漏洞的快速响应。
5. 培训与意识提升
- 安全培训:定期对员工进行安全意识和技能培训,使他们了解如何安全地使用系统和处理敏感信息。这包括教授他们识别钓鱼攻击、恶意软件和其他网络威胁的技能。
- 安全政策宣贯:确保所有员工都了解公司的安全政策和程序,以及他们在日常工作中的责任。这有助于建立一个安全文化,使员工成为组织安全的第一道防线。
6. 持续改进与更新
- 反馈机制:建立有效的反馈机制,鼓励员工报告安全问题和提出改进建议。这有助于及时发现和修复潜在的安全漏洞。
- 技术更新:随着技术的发展,定期评估和更新权限管理系统,以确保其与最新的安全标准和威胁情报保持同步。这包括升级到更安全的技术和工具,以应对新的安全挑战。
综上所述,一个高效的权限管理系统不仅能够确保数据的安全和完整性,还能够提高组织的运营效率和合规性。通过明确权限需求、设计合理的权限模型、实现严格的权限控制、定期进行审计与监控、加强员工的安全意识以及持续改进与更新,我们可以构建一个既安全又高效的权限管理系统,为组织的稳健发展提供坚实的保障。